Icon6 aPexi vafcII install?

my friend gave me his vtec controller and i want to install this in my 93 Prelude but i have a tuned ecu. i just want this for LOOKS ONLY not for tuning or anything that would mess uP my setuP. is this Possible?

Default Re: aPexi vafcII install?

It's possible. You can connect a VAFC and not change any settings. It will just display whatever you tell it to. I highly recommend getting the PnP harness so you don't have to splice/solder anything.
